>> This patch implements ATA_FLAG_SETXFER_POLLING and use in pata_via.
>> If this flag is set, transfer mode setting performed by polling not by
>> interrupt. This should help those controllers which raise interrupt
>> before the command is actually complete on SETXFER.
>>
>> Rationale for this approach.
>>
>> * uses existing facility and relatively simple
>> * no busy sleep in the interrupt handler
>> * updating drivers is easy
